Bill Belichick responds to Demaryius Thomas ripping Patriots

Bill Belichick

Demaryius Thomas feels that Bill Belichick misled him during the veteran receiver’s brief time with the New England Patriots, but that is not the way Belichick remembers it.

Thomas unloaded on the Patriots this week and said signing with them turned out to be a “waste of time.” He said he was told his spot on the regular season roster would be safe after New England released him initially, so he stuck around and re-signed with the team. That was before Antonio Brown was cut by the Oakland Raiders, which changed things and made Thomas the odd man out.

While speaking with reporters on Thursday, Belichick acknowledged that the circumstances surrounding Thomas changed but said he “felt like I was always truthful with him.”

Thomas has been around long enough to know that the NFL is a business. It’s certainly possible — if not probable — that the Patriots had every intention of keeping him around until Brown became available. No one could have predicted that one of the best wide receivers in football would suddenly become a free agent and want to sign with New England, so the Patriots felt they could not pass up the opportunity.

If Thomas wants to, he can take pleasure in the way the Brown signing turned out for the Patriots. However, the implication that the Patriots should have kept their word no matter what is unrealistic. That’s not how professional sports work.
